Aural Clinic.
Mr. R. M. Savege, F.R.C.S., M.B., Ch.B., D.L.O., who was
for many years the Authority's Ear Nose and Throat Surgeon,
continues to attend the Aural Clinic by arrangements with the
Regional Hospital Board. Mr. Savege attends one session weekly.
The following are the statistical details:—
Number of clinic sessions 50
Number of children attending 467
Number of attendances 1,206
Number of children discharged 520
